logo

Output 432a80577e3b50018f722634fbed4045d94c8fa895155901a533332388ca9e87:0

value
2000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10ca0efac137e8b65d592539558d0a20ed749477 OP_EQUALVERIFY OP_CHECKSIG
address
12XmsLmwNNfdpzM1ipqU8muges42WtNTr9
transaction
432a80577e3b50018f722634fbed4045d94c8fa895155901a533332388ca9e87